jerovsek wrote:Hello zio_mangrovia,
if data are valuable for you, then contact pro recovery service.
There are a lot of problems with WD caviar green(ROM or heads).
Do you hear some clicking noise from drive?
For DIY you will need drive with identical data on sticker and ypu will need to transfer ROM to donor drive.
If you don't have tools and knowledge, then outsource it.

fzabkar wrote:The drive has a reserved System Area (SA) that contains various firmware modules. There is also some firmware in the flash memory on the PCB.
SeDiv (demo version) is a software tool that can read the above firmware. Many problems in WD drives are related to "damaged" SA modules, eg MOD 32.
